Homemade Spanish Tomato Pasta Sauce

Servings: 4

Ingredients:

Instructions:

  1. Sauté Onions:

    • Heat olive oil in a flat nonstick pan over medium heat.
    • Add the chopped onion and sauté for 10 minutes until slightly brown.
  2. Add Garlic:

    • Add the minced garlic to the pan and sauté until fragrant.
  3. Cook Tomatoes:

    • Incorporate the chopped Roma tomatoes into the pan and continue to sauté until they begin to soften.
  4. Season:

    • Sprinkle in the Spanish paprika, dried basil, granulated onion, granulated garlic, sea salt, black pepper, and oregano leaves.
    • Mix well to evenly distribute the spices.
  5. Simmer:

    • Cover the pan and reduce the heat to low.
    • Let the sauce simmer for 15 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ld.
  6. Cool and Blend:

    • Remove from heat and allow the sauce to cool for 15 minutes.
    • Transfer the sauce to a blender and purée until smooth.
  7. Serve:

    • Spoon the freshly made tomato sauce over your favorite cooked pasta.
    • Sprinkle with freshly grated Parmesan cheese for an extra touch of flavor.
